Handover note — landlord site audit, Westrel House

For the facilities desk: Bramleigh Estates, our landlord, is conducting their annual site audit Wednesday and Thursday. Their two assessors will inspect fire doors, riser cupboards, and the plant room on the roof. Please have the maintenance logs printed and on the desk by Tuesday evening, and flag the pending repair list so nothing looks hidden. Escort them at all times in restricted areas. The plant room keypad was recently reset, so use the updated code given below.

door code, tagef-bajop: bdg-SB-7

CI note for security review — Tumblebox locker flow

The end-to-end test for the laundry-locker access flow fails intermittently on the Kestrelwood runners because the mock PIN service returns before the audit log flush completes, so the assertion on the access record races. We added an explicit flush barrier and re-ran the suite twenty times with zero failures. Unlock codes in tests are synthetic and rotate per run. The passing run is traceable via the identifier below.

session token of tajef-bageg = htk21_5d90d574934f3ccae6437

## PR: New payroll export format for Fernhollow

Heads up for the weekly sync — this swaps the old fixed-width payroll export for the delimited format the Copperline processor wants. Rounding now happens per line item instead of per batch, which killed the penny-drift bug Mira flagged last quarter. Old exports still work behind a flag through next cycle. Worth eyeballing the rounding and batching constants before we merge; they're pasted below.

tuning table, faduf-baduf:
PRIORITIES = {
    "ulavan": 191,
    "silys": 750,
    "goriel": 238,
    "kelmir": 66,
    "wendor": 432,
}

# Handover: soft deletes in the orders table

Hey — quick context before you inherit Cartfield. Orders are never hard-deleted; we set deleted_at and every query is supposed to filter on it. "Supposed to" is doing heavy lifting: a couple of reporting jobs still ignore the flag, so totals occasionally include ghosts. There's a half-finished migration to a view that bakes the filter in. Don't purge rows manually, finance reconciles against them. If anything here bites you, the person to ping is below.

account owner for fajep-yagef: Kasix Eliiel